Flarum\Extension\ExtensionManager::getExtension PHP Метод

getExtension() публичный Метод

Loads an Extension with all information.
public getExtension ( string $name ) : Extension | null
$name string
Результат Extension | null
    public function getExtension($name)
    {
        return $this->getExtensions()->get($name);
    }

Usage Example

Пример #1
0
 protected function delete(ServerRequestInterface $request)
 {
     $this->assertAdmin($request->getAttribute('actor'));
     $name = array_get($request->getQueryParams(), 'name');
     $extension = $this->extensions->getExtension($name);
     $this->extensions->disable($extension);
     $this->extensions->uninstall($extension);
 }